WebIf your statement shows that you have a balance due because you exceeded your benefit limit, this is information we receive from your insurance company. They are stating that they have paid up to the maximum limit they provide coverage for, and that the patient is responsible for the remaining balance. WebTo exceed is to go beyond expectations, or to go too far. If you exceed the speed limit, you might get a speeding ticket. Exceed and excess share the Latin root excedere meaning to "go beyond." An excess is too much of something, like the piles of candy after Halloween, and exceed means the action of going too far in a good or bad way. WebCredit card limits, explained. In simplest terms, a credit card limit — also known as a credit line — is the maximum amount that a person can spend on their card, set by the credit card issuer. But there's more to it than that. Learn more about what a credit card limit is, what can happen if you go over your limit and how a limit may be ...
